The decrease is $ 100\pi - 64\pi = \boxed{36\pi} \, \text{km}^2 $. 📰 Question: A zoologist tracks an animal’s path forming a right triangle with hypotenuse $ 25 \, \text{m} $ and inradius $ 6 \, \text{m} $. What is the ratio of the inscribed circle’s area to the triangle’s area? 📰 Solution: For a right triangle, the inradius $ r = \frac{a + b - c}{2} $, where $ c $ is the hypotenuse. Let $ a $ and $ b $ be the legs. Then $ r = \frac{a + b - 25}{2} = 6 \Rightarrow a + b = 37 $. The area of the triangle is $ \frac{ab}{2} $, and the inradius formula $ r = \frac{a + b - c}{2} $ gives consistency. Using $ a^2 + b^2 = 625 $ and $ a + b = 37 $, solve for $ ab $: $ (a + b)^2 = 1369 = a^2 + b^2 + 2ab = 625 + 2ab \Rightarrow ab = 372 $. Area $ = 186 \, \text{m}^2 $. Circle area $ \pi r^2 = 36\pi $.
